Governor Jerry Brown Signs the Medical Cannabis Organ Transplant Bill
Sacramento, CA –(ENEWSPF)–July 7, 2015. Yesterday Governor Jerry Brown signed AB 258, the Medical Cannabis Organ Transplant Act. AB 258 prohibits discrimination against medical cannabis patients in the organ transplant process, unless a doctor has determined that medical cannabis use is clinically significant to the transplant process.
